- [ ] Inventory reconciliation job (Cordavel) — key rotation. Security reviewer confirms the old signing key for the Cordavel reconciliation job has been revoked, the new key is loaded into the job's vault, and a dry-run reconciles without drift against last night's warehouse counts. Record the vault version in the ceremony log. Should the vault require manual unsealing during review, the recovery passphrase is noted directly beneath this item.

unlock words, kagef-taduf: fenir-quenix-norwyn-sorvan-gormir-gorir-fraok

**Ticket: Config drift in Fixturesmith across staging runners**

Priority: Medium-ish, but annoying

Heads up — the Fixturesmith test-data factory is generating different record shapes on runner pool B versus A. Looks like pool B never picked up last month's seed and locale changes, so snapshot tests pass there and fail everywhere else. Classic drift. Someone hand-edited the runner config and it never made it back into the repo. Can you reconcile pool B tonight before the release branch cut? The intended values, for reference, are:

service settings:
PRAIX_LOG_LEVEL=error
PRAIX_METRICS_HOST=metrics.praix.qorvelcorp.corp
PRAIX_POOL_SIZE=16

## Tuning the Replica Lag Alarm

The Fernhollow billing cluster pages support whenever read-replica lag crosses the warning threshold for two consecutive probes. Before adjusting anything, confirm the lag is sustained and not a backup-window artifact — most Tuesday alerts are. Lowering the threshold increases noise; raising it delays detection of genuine replication stalls, so change values in small steps and watch for a full day. The current defaults are listed below.

constants for tagef-kagug:
QUOTAS = {
    "ulaix": 10,
    "holwyn": 2,
}

## Onboarding: Farebranch Rules Engine

Plugin authors integrate with Farebranch by registering fee rules against the evaluation API. Rules are sandboxed; they cannot perform network calls directly. All rate-table lookups go through the host, which validates your plugin manifest at load time. Your local env file must include the signing credential the host uses to verify manifests, set on the next line.

secret setting of bajef-fajof: COURIER_KEY3=76c